Choosing the correct drill bit size for tapping a 1/4-20 thread is crucial for creating clean, strong, and accurate threads. Using the wrong size can lead to stripped threads, a broken tap, or a poor-fitting fastener. This guide will walk you through determining the ideal drill bit size and address some common questions.
The most important thing to understand is that you don't simply use a 1/4" drill bit. The 1/4-20 refers to a thread size (1/4" diameter) and threads per inch (20). The drill bit size needs to be slightly smaller to allow for the material to be displaced as the tap cuts the threads.
The recommended drill bit size for a 1/4-20 tap is typically #7 or 0.201 inches. However, this can vary slightly depending on the material you're tapping into. Here's why:

What Happens if I Use the Wrong Drill Bit Size?
Using the wrong size drill bit can have several negative consequences:
- Stripped Threads: If the hole is too small, the tap will bind and potentially strip the threads, rendering the hole unusable.
- Broken Tap: A hole that's too small increases the risk of the tap breaking off inside the workpiece.
- Poor Thread Fit: If the hole is too large, the threads will be weak and the fastener may not grip properly, leading to a loose or unreliable connection.
